What You Should Do After a Car Accident in Pasadena, TX

    1. Call 911: Make sure a police report is filed.

    1. Document Everything: Photos, names, insurance, and locations.

    1. Seek Medical Attention: Even if you feel okay — internal injuries are real.

What Is Your Car Accident Case Worth?

Every case is different, but we fight to get you compensation for:

    • Medical bills (present and future)

    • Lost wages and earning capacity

    • Pain and suffering

    • Property damage

    • Loss of enjoyment of life

    • Wrongful death damages (if applicable)

Q: What’s the statute of limitations in Texas for car accidents?
A: Two years from the date of the accident. Don’t wait — evidence disappears fast.
